    I think that those decks are fine but only against a field with no wastelands, ie a meta call deck. You are already bad against wasteland as is, adding the colors just amplifies that. Also the colors don't give you cards to help you against your bad match ups. You are good against fair mid range decks, the color cards really only help against them. IMO stick with colorless.

    I played Eldrazi to a 6-3 record at SCG Worcester (cut off for day 2 was 7-2).

    4 Ancient Tomb
    2 City of Traitors
    4 Eldrazi Temple
    4 Eye of Ugin
    3 Cavern of Souls
    3 Wasteland
    3 Mishra's Factory
    1 Karakas
    1 Urborg, Tomb of Yawgmoth
    3 Simian Spirit Guide
    4 Eldrazi Mimic
    4 Matter Reshaper
    4 Thought-Knot Seer
    4 Reality Smasher
    2 Endbringer
    4 Endless One
    2 Walking Ballista
    4 Chalice of the Void
    2 Umezawa's Jitte
    2 Dismember
    --
    1 Karakas
    3 Thorn of Amethyst
    2 Sorcerous Spyglass
    1 Ratchet Bomb
    2 Warping Wail
    4 Leyline of the Void
    2 All is Dust

    Round 1: James on Mono Red Moon (Win 2-1)
    My opponent was on an unusual list running the full 12 Moons (Blood Moon, Magus of the Moon, and Blood Sun) with Sneak Attack and Through the Breach as his win cons. I've played against similar decks and knew to keep hands with Spirit Guides, Mimics, Ballistas, and Jittes because those were the cards I could cast through a Moon effect. An aggressive Eye of Ugin/ Mimic draw get me there in game 1, and a well timed Sorcerous Spyglass on Sneak Attack wins me the match.

    Round 2: Anthony on Infect (Win 2-1)
    Game one I'm on the play and I have a hand with Thought-Knot, Ballista, 2 Ancient Tomb, 2 Wasteland, and Endbringer. Obviously I keep it blind, but I tanked on whether or not to jam a 1/1 Walking Ballista against an unknown opponent. My sketchy play panned out as my opponent couldn't cast any of his creatures for the first four or five turns because they would all die to Ballista. Post-board we have so many tools for Infect, it seems like a very favorable match up.

    Round 3: Mike on B/R Reanimator (Win 2-1)
    Pretty quick games. I lose game one because I keep an aggro hand without Chalice. Game two I have both Leyline and Chalice of the Void X=1 on turn one. game three I have a Leyline which he eventually casts Wear/Tear on, but I am able to play an Endbringer and neutralize his threat while pinging him for one damage a turn.

    Round 4: Edgar on Czech Pile (Loss 0-2)
    The most lopsided games against my favor all weekend. Game one I cast a Thought-Knot into his Leovold, which is promptly Fatal Pushed, a fun interaction that nets him 2 cards, including a Baleful Strix. Game two I Thought-Knot him and see Abrupt Decay, Lightning Bolt, Fatal Push, Snapcaster Mage, and Toxic Deluge. Can't beat that.

    Round 5: Thomas on Punishing Jund (Win 2-0)
    From the first Eldrazi Mimic I cast, my opponent visibly lacks confidence, doesn't seem to think he can beat Eldazi and pretty much hands me the game. Game two I bring in some Leylines of the Void (maybe two copies - I forget, but not all four) and hit one in my opening 7. Now that he's off Tarmogoyf, Deathrite, and Punishing Fire, I force him to overextend into an All is Dust.

    Round 6: Dan on Sneak & Show (Win 2-1)
    Didn't take many notes for these games. S&S feels like a slightly disfavorable match up.

    Game three I mull to five cards and keep City of Traitors, Wasteland, Thorn of Amethyst, Endless One, and Endbringer on the play. I play City into Thorn on turn one. He plays a Volc and passes. Turn two I draw a Simian Spirit Guide and decide I need to get pressure on the board. I cast a 3/3 Endless One off City and SSG and Wasteland my opponent. However I missed my City of Traitors trigger and pass the turn. My opponent doesn't notice it either. For two turn cycles, I draw an uncastable spell, attack for 3 and pass. Then we realize I missed my City of Traitors trigger and a Judge gets called over to the table. The floor Judge clearly doesn't know what to do, and calls the Head Judge. I get pulled aside from the table and basically interrogated (he suspects I'm cheating) to the point where he asks me how long I've been playing Eldrazi, what my game plan for the Sneak and Show match up was etc. Given that I hadn't even used the City of Traitors for mana since it was supposed to have been sacrificed, he ends up giving me a missed trigger warning and we continue playing. I ended up winning that game without playing another card, just by attacking for 3 every turn with a Thorn of Amethyst in play. Weird.

    Round 7: Justin on Aggro Loam (Loss 1-2)
    I play a Chalice X=1 game one and quickly realize it does nothing. His Knights of the Reliquary are larger than my Eldrazi and he has time to tutor up Maze of Ith. We get into a topdeck war in which he gets Liliana of the Veil and Scavenging Ooze. I lose. Game two I have the nut Eye/Mimic aggro draw and game three he outgrinds me again.

    Round 8: John on Sneak & Show (Loss 1-2)
    All three games were pretty much uninteractive races to zero and he wins the die roll and has the faster deck.

    Round 9: Ameth on B/R Reanimator (Win 2-0)
    I cast an early Reality Smasher. My opponent Gets a Griselbrand with Animate Dead, draws 7 and passes. I topdeck another Smasher and attack with both. He blocks and I Dismember Griselbrand. We do combat math and he tells me he gains 7 life. I'm like "wait, what?" I call a Judge over to the table and explain that he should be gaining one life off his 1/2 (dismember+animate dead) Griselbrand and I trample over for 8. Of course the Judge agrees with me, and the Griselbrand dies.
    Game two He gets a Tidespout Tyrant and I dismember it. Then he Animates it again and I dismember it again. Then I kill him with some 4/4's.

    Anyway, the list was pretty good. I probably want a fourth Wasteland though. Also a huge Congrats to my friends from my LGS Dylan Hand and Noah Walker on their respective Top8s. They're certainly better players than I am. Until next time, Legacy is sweet.

    This is the current version I'm playing:



    The mana base is almost identical to what you show, but +1 Wastes -1 Corrupted Crossroads


    Why Wastes?
    Your most power cards, in order are: Chalice, TKS, Reality Smasher. You want to ensure having answers to Blood Moon effects in the main board to cast the latter two. Also, having Wastes will let you get a land from Ghost Quarter, Path to Exile and Veteran Explorer. The consistency gain by replacing said Wastes with Crossroads is definitely smaller than the benefits of having a Wastes.



    Deck Choices
    The rest of the creatures each fulfill different roles over a curve. You also gain evasion with Skyspawner and Bearer; Pseudo evasion/removal with Displacer and Drowner.

    I noticed that many seem the 4x Ballista as too many; but in my experience, this card is very versatile in dealing with troublesome matchups. The most relevant function is eliminating opposing Baleful Strix.

    The 1x mb 1x sb Karakas is in response to the growing presence of Turbo Depths and RB Reanimator.

    The +1 Sword of (Fire and Ice OR Light and Shadow) is a tech borrowed from Steel Stompy. According to Amadeus (the most successful pilot of that deck) the Sword is more powerful in the current meta full of TNN and Strix. I have tried both swords and I somewhat agree that is very castable and usable, and that it helps in some games that would otherwise be unwinnable. On the other hand it's still not clear whether the tempo loss has cost me other games. But so far, it seems like the substitution is very viable.



    Isn't the colorless version better?
    The colorless version is faster and more consistently deployed. The colorful version gives you more flexibility and consistency across multiple archetypes. Or in other words, for example many of your 65% matchups become 62% but your 45% matchups become 53%. Most notable examples where you GAIN win%: Show and Tell, Reanimator, Turbo Depths, Grixis Delver, D&T, Elves. Most notable examples of REDUCTION in win%: BUG control/delver, Moon Stompy, Miracles, Eldrazi Post, Storm, Burn




    How does it fair vs. Wasteland?
    I believe that both the colorless and the colorful versions are affected in a similar proportion by Wasteland. The color requirement is almost always met even under pressure from Wastelands, the problem is when opponents deploy early wastelands with pressure and we fail to draw sufficient Sol lands, which would be the same issue with the colorless version.
